We opened a new door for artistic expression in Meta’s Horizon Metaverse. An extraordinary painter known as Weirdo joined us with a clear vision: to bring his works into a metaverse where his art could be experienced in a completely new and immersive way.
Weirdo is a painter without hands, whose career has been marked by his remarkable ability to overcome physical limitations and create captivating works of art. Our mission was to transform these works into three-dimensional representations, accessible through virtual reality, allowing visitors to explore and experience his art from a totally innovative perspective.
The development began with an in-depth analysis of Weirdo’s works, understanding not only his techniques and styles but also the essence and emotions that each piece conveyed. The goal was to capture the same intensity and purity, but in a format that would allow users to interact with the pieces in an immersive way.
In the metaverse, each of Weirdo’s works became a unique three-dimensional space, where one could not only observe but also navigate and explore from different angles. Virtual reality offered a new dimension to the art, allowing for a deeper and more personal connection with each piece. Users could get close, see details that might be missed in a traditional gallery, and feel as though they were within the artist’s creative process.
The result was a virtual exhibition that not only celebrated Weirdo’s talent and perseverance but also highlighted the infinite possibilities of art in the metaverse. Participant feedback was overwhelmingly positive, with many noting how the experience allowed them to appreciate art in a completely new way.
